Problem
Existing vibration motors face challenges with complex and space-consuming electrical connections, which hinder their performance and reliability due to cabling issues.
Innovation Solution
A vibration motor design featuring a primary coil connected to the outside to generate an alternating electromagnetic field, inducing vibration in a secondary coil, eliminating the need for internal cables and simplifying the structure.

1Reliability
If welding a conductive wire to a circuit board is used for electrical connection, then electrical connection is achieved, but the structure becomes complex and occupies large space
Solution Approach 1:
The patent extracts and removes the complex cabling system (conductive wires and welding connections) from the vibration motor structure. Instead of using traditional wired electrical connections, the invention employs wireless power transmission through electromagnetic coupling between a primary coil and secondary coil, thereby eliminating the harmful factor of complex cabling while maintaining reliable electrical connection functionality
Solution Approach 2:
The patent replaces the mechanical electrical connection system (physical wires and welding joints) with an electromagnetic field-based power transmission system. The primary coil generates an alternating magnetic field that induces current in the secondary coil, substituting the mechanical cabling approach with a field-based energy transfer mechanism that reduces structural complexity and improves reliability

A vibration motor in the present disclosure includes a housing having an accommodating space, a first vibrator accommodated in the housing and having a magnetic steel, a driving apparatus disposed opposite to the magnetic steel and configured to drive the first vibrator, an elastic part elastically supporting the first vibrator, and a circuit board. The vibration motor further includes a primary coil electrically connected to the circuit board. The driving apparatus is a secondary coil disposed separately from the primary coil. The primary coil is electrically connected to the outside by using the circuit board to generate an alternating electromagnetic field, to cause the secondary coil and generates an induced electromotive force, and cause relative vibration between the secondary coil and the first vibrator. The present disclosure simplified structure, saved space, and avoided reliability problems such as winding and breaking, thereby effectively improving the product reliability performance.
